1899. Burnett, Frances Hodgson. IN CONNECTION WITH THE DE WILLOUGHBY CLAIM. New York: Charles Scribner's Sons, 1899. 445p, decorated cloth, binding slightly cocked, spine darkened, inner hinge crackes, good. 1st edition. BAL 2093. Burnett (1849-1924) was the author of nearly 50 books for adults and children, the most famous of which was "Little Lord Fauntleroy" (1886).
